技术博客
惊喜好礼享不停
技术博客
Abiquo公司创新之作:abiCloud开源云计算平台探秘

Abiquo公司创新之作:abiCloud开源云计算平台探秘

作者: 万维易源
2024-08-21
AbiquoabiCloud开源云平台IT基础设施

摘要

近日,Abiquo公司宣布推出一款名为'abiCloud'的开源云计算平台。这款平台致力于帮助企业以更快速、简便且可扩展的方式构建和管理其IT基础设施,包括虚拟服务器、网络、应用程序及存储设备等。为了帮助用户更好地理解和使用'abiCloud',本文提供了丰富的代码示例,便于读者学习和参考。

关键词

Abiquo, abiCloud, 开源, 云平台, IT基础设施

一、开源云计算平台介绍

信息可能包含敏感信息。

二、abiCloud的功能与应用

信息可能包含敏感信息。

三、abiCloud的使用与技巧

3.1 代码示例解析

在深入探讨abiCloud的代码示例之前,让我们先感受一下它如何简化了云资源的管理和配置。abiCloud通过一系列直观的API接口,使得开发者能够轻松地创建、监控并调整虚拟机(VMs)的状态。例如,只需几行简洁的代码,就可以启动一个新的虚拟服务器实例。下面是一个简单的示例,展示了如何使用abiCloud API创建一个虚拟机:

# 导入必要的库
from abicloud import AbiCloudClient

# 初始化客户端
client = AbiCloudClient('https://your-abiquo-server.com', 'username', 'password')

# 定义虚拟机配置
vm_config = {
    "name": "My New VM",
    "cpu": 2,
    "memory": 4096,
    "disk_size": 50,
    "os_type": "Ubuntu 20.04"
}

# 创建虚拟机
new_vm = client.create_vm(vm_config)

print(f"New VM created: {new_vm.name}")

这段代码不仅展示了abiCloud的强大功能,还体现了其易用性和灵活性。通过这样的示例,即使是初学者也能快速上手,开始构建自己的云环境。

3.2 实践中的性能优化

对于那些希望进一步提升abiCloud性能的企业来说,有一些关键的实践技巧可以帮助他们实现这一目标。首先,合理规划虚拟机的资源分配至关重要。例如,根据实际需求动态调整CPU和内存配置,可以显著提高资源利用率。此外,利用abiCloud的自动化工具来监控和管理虚拟机的状态,也是提高效率的有效手段之一。

另一个重要的方面是网络优化。通过优化网络配置,比如设置合理的带宽限制和优先级策略,可以有效减少延迟和丢包率,从而提升整体性能。例如,在高负载情况下,合理配置网络流量控制机制,可以确保关键业务不受影响。

3.3 常见问题与解决方案

尽管abiCloud提供了强大的功能和灵活的配置选项,但在实际部署过程中,用户可能会遇到一些常见问题。例如,虚拟机启动缓慢或响应时间过长等问题。为了解决这些问题,可以尝试以下几种方法:

  • 检查资源分配:确保每个虚拟机都有足够的CPU和内存资源。
  • 优化存储方案:使用更快的存储介质,如SSD,可以显著提高读写速度。
  • 网络配置调整:合理规划网络架构,避免不必要的网络瓶颈。

通过上述措施,大多数性能相关的问题都可以得到有效解决。此外,abiCloud社区也是一个宝贵的资源库,用户可以在其中找到更多实用的建议和技术支持。

四、abiCloud的企业级特性

信息可能包含敏感信息。

五、abiCloud在行业中的应用与前景

5.1 与主流云平台的对比

在当今竞争激烈的云计算市场中,abiCloud凭借其独特的定位和优势脱颖而出。与市场上其他主流云平台相比,abiCloud更加注重灵活性和定制化能力,这使得企业在构建和管理IT基础设施时拥有更大的自由度。例如,AWS和Azure等云服务提供商虽然提供了广泛的服务和强大的功能,但它们往往要求用户遵循特定的架构设计和工作流程。而abiCloud则不同,它允许企业根据自身需求灵活选择和配置资源,从而实现更高的效率和成本效益。

此外,abiCloud的开源特性也是一大亮点。这意味着开发者可以自由地访问和修改源代码,以适应特定的需求或进行创新性的开发。这种开放性不仅降低了企业的技术门槛,还促进了社区内的知识共享和技术进步。相比之下,许多商业云平台对源代码进行了严格的保护,限制了用户的自定义能力。

5.2 未来发展方向与展望

展望未来,abiCloud将继续致力于技术创新和服务优化,以满足不断变化的企业需求。一方面,随着人工智能和大数据技术的发展,abiCloud计划集成更多的智能工具和服务,帮助企业更高效地处理海量数据,挖掘潜在价值。另一方面,abiCloud也将加强与物联网(IoT)领域的合作,为企业提供更加全面的云解决方案,助力其实现数字化转型。

此外,abiCloud还将持续关注可持续发展和社会责任议题。通过采用绿色计算技术和优化能源管理策略,abiCloud旨在降低数据中心的碳足迹,推动行业的可持续发展。同时,abiCloud也将积极参与开源社区建设,鼓励更多的开发者参与到开源项目中来,共同推动云计算技术的进步和发展。

5.3 客户案例分享

来自不同行业的企业已经从abiCloud中受益匪浅。例如,一家位于亚洲的初创公司利用abiCloud快速搭建了一个高性能的云计算平台,成功支持了其在线教育平台的运营。通过灵活配置虚拟服务器和存储资源,该公司不仅大幅降低了运维成本,还提高了系统的稳定性和可靠性。此外,abiCloud提供的丰富API接口也让该公司能够轻松集成第三方服务,进一步增强了用户体验。

另一家欧洲的零售企业则借助abiCloud实现了其全球供应链的数字化升级。通过利用abiCloud的自动化工具和高级分析功能,该企业能够实时监控库存状态,优化物流配送路径,从而显著提升了供应链效率。这些成功案例不仅证明了abiCloud的强大功能,也为其他企业提供了宝贵的经验借鉴。

六、总结

综上所述,Abiquo推出的abiCloud开源云计算平台为企业提供了一种快速、简便且可扩展的方式来构建和管理IT基础设施。通过丰富的代码示例,即便是新手也能迅速掌握如何使用abiCloud进行虚拟机的创建与管理。此外,abiCloud还提供了多种性能优化策略,帮助企业提高资源利用率和系统效率。与市场上其他主流云平台相比,abiCloud更注重灵活性和定制化能力,同时其开源特性也促进了技术的创新与共享。展望未来,abiCloud将持续推进技术创新和服务优化,助力企业实现数字化转型的同时,也积极推动行业的可持续发展。